What type of shoes should a student wear while working with chemical and with glassware

Chemistry
2 answers:
Maru [420]3 years ago
6 0
Other than boots etc, a student could also wear 'close toed shoes'
r-ruslan [8.4K]3 years ago
5 0
Sturdy shoes/ boots (preferably steel capped) not open toes or trainers.
